Retirement Program

There is no pension system in Tanzania, but there are communities that care for the elderly.

Typically, older family members are relying on their children to care and provide for them.

We support our farmers to plan with their retirement and offer tree programs that allows them be more self-sufficient.

The trees that we promote grow slowly and provide a sustainable secondary income after ten years of growth.

This not only supports the financial situation of the farmers and fixes carbon oxides; it also is part of our organic TANKAR-Coffee quality because shade-grown coffee grows slower and develops more taste.

The variety of 30 different deciduous trees provide shade, protect wildlife like birds and increases the biodiversity of our gardens to keep our high TANKAR-Quality in the future.
